XML 89 R74.htm IDEA: XBRL DOCUMENT v3.24.0.1
Equity Incentive Plans - Additional Information (Detail) - USD ($)
$ / shares in Units, $ in Thousands
1 Months Ended 12 Months Ended
Jan. 01, 2024
Oct. 31, 2017
Aug. 31, 2017
Dec. 31, 2023
Dec. 31, 2022
Dec. 31, 2021
Jan. 31, 2024
Feb. 29, 2020
Share Based Compensation Arrangement By Share Based Payment Award [Line Items]                
Common stock reserved for future issuance       19,180,000 16,793,000 13,576,000    
Stock options vesting period       48 months        
Stock options vesting description       Options granted to employees on or after December 5, 2013 generally vest in installments of (i) 25% at the one-year anniversary and (ii) in either 36 equal monthly or 12 equal quarterly installments beginning in the thirteenth month after the initial vesting commencement date (as defined) subject to the employee’s continuous service with the Company.        
Aggregate number of stock options granted to purchase common stock       838,000 1,300,000 2,700,000    
Weighted - Average Grant Date Fair Value Per Option, Granted       $ 34.26 $ 23.62 $ 30.72    
Aggregate intrinsic value of options exercised in period       $ 181,000 $ 44,800 $ 39,900    
Fair market value of options vested in period       46,800 $ 59,000 53,200    
Unrecognized compensation expense       $ 46,100        
Estimated weighted-average period to recognize       2 years 2 months 4 days        
Common stock, issued       119,556,000 110,772,000      
Common stock issued at average per share price       $ 20.11        
Share-based compensation expense       $ 105,945 $ 91,085 $ 70,667    
Restricted Stock Units [Member]                
Share Based Compensation Arrangement By Share Based Payment Award [Line Items]                
Unrecognized compensation expense       $ 155,500        
Estimated weighted-average period to recognize       2 years 7 months 6 days        
Aggregate intrinsic value of restricted grants vested       $ 55,300        
Fair market value of restricted stock units vested       $ 42,200        
Frist Anniversary [Member]                
Share Based Compensation Arrangement By Share Based Payment Award [Line Items]                
Stock options vesting percentage       25.00%        
Second Anniversary [Member]                
Share Based Compensation Arrangement By Share Based Payment Award [Line Items]                
Stock options vesting percentage       25.00%        
Third Anniversary [Member]                
Share Based Compensation Arrangement By Share Based Payment Award [Line Items]                
Stock options vesting percentage       25.00%        
Fourth Anniversary [Member]                
Share Based Compensation Arrangement By Share Based Payment Award [Line Items]                
Stock options vesting percentage       25.00%        
Subsequent Event [Member]                
Share Based Compensation Arrangement By Share Based Payment Award [Line Items]                
Shares issuable increased during the period 200,000              
Equity Incentive Plan 2010 [Member]                
Share Based Compensation Arrangement By Share Based Payment Award [Line Items]                
Common stock shares reserved for issuance     6,188,466          
Percentage of voting shares     10.00%          
Options expire from issuance date     10 years          
Equity Incentive Plan 2010 [Member] | Maximum [Member]                
Share Based Compensation Arrangement By Share Based Payment Award [Line Items]                
Percentage of estimated fair value per share of common stock on the date of grant     100.00%          
Equity Incentive Plan 2010 [Member] | Minimum [Member]                
Share Based Compensation Arrangement By Share Based Payment Award [Line Items]                
Percentage price of each share of the fair value on date of grant     110.00%          
2017 Stock Incentive Plan [Member]                
Share Based Compensation Arrangement By Share Based Payment Award [Line Items]                
Common stock shares reserved for issuance   1,359,587            
Percentage of voting shares   4.00%            
Number of shares available for future grant   299,568   6,497,120        
Shares issuable increased during the period   4,219,409            
Common Stock Issuance Description       equal to the lowest of 4,219,409 shares of common stock, 4.0% of the number of shares of common stock outstanding on the first day of the fiscal year and an amount determined by the board of directors.        
Common stock reserved for future issuance       16,989,000 14,271,000 11,014,000    
2017 Stock Incentive Plan [Member] | Subsequent Event [Member]                
Share Based Compensation Arrangement By Share Based Payment Award [Line Items]                
Number of shares available for future grant             4,219,409  
2020 Inducement Stock Incentive Plan [Member]                
Share Based Compensation Arrangement By Share Based Payment Award [Line Items]                
Number of shares available for future grant       354,466        
Common stock reserved for future issuance       1,638,000 1,857,000 1,761,000   750,000
2020 Inducement Stock Incentive Plan [Member] | Subsequent Event [Member]                
Share Based Compensation Arrangement By Share Based Payment Award [Line Items]                
Number of shares available for future grant 1,950,000              
2017 Employee Stock Purchase Plan [Member]                
Share Based Compensation Arrangement By Share Based Payment Award [Line Items]                
Common stock shares reserved for issuance   468,823            
Percentage of voting shares       1.00%        
2017 Employee Stock Purchase Plan [Member] | Maximum [Member]                
Share Based Compensation Arrangement By Share Based Payment Award [Line Items]                
Common stock reserved for future issuance       937,646        
Employee Stock Purchase Plan [Member]                
Share Based Compensation Arrangement By Share Based Payment Award [Line Items]                
Percentage price of each share of the fair value on date of grant       85.00%        
Number of shares available for future grant       552,881        
Common stock reserved for future issuance       0        
Percentage of earnings withheld to purchase shares of common stock       15.00%        
Common stock, issued       112,064        
Common stock issued at average per share price       $ 48        
Cash received from issuance of purchase rights       $ 5,400        
Share-based compensation expense       $ 2,100